#602205 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#602205 is composed of 37.6% red, 13.3%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 64.6% magenta, 94.8%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 19.1 degrees, a saturation of 90.1% and a lightness of 19.8%. #602205 color hex could be obtained by blending #c0440a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

#602205 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#602205 has RGB values of R:96, G:34,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.65, Y:0.95,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 6300165.

Shades and Tints of #602205
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030100 is the darkest color, while #fef4ef is the lightest one.
